Output ff26a0af898e47be7c5a6f8acb880f6cd8c30dafef1d6bc64c81cd67dcae231a:0

value
6951203993101
script pubkey
OP_0 OP_PUSHBYTES_20 3e43fe7f98ae56c501a4bac2c00274277e5e6409
address
tb1q8epluluc4etv2qdyhtpvqqn5yal9ueqfp9etj5
transaction
ff26a0af898e47be7c5a6f8acb880f6cd8c30dafef1d6bc64c81cd67dcae231a
confirmations
182594
spent
true